随着无线网络技术的普及,如何确保无线网络的安全性成为了企业和个人用户共同面临的挑战
Aircrack作为一款强大的无线网络破解工具,因其出色的性能和广泛的应用场景而备受推崇
然而,很多安全测试人员在使用Aircrack时,可能会遇到硬件限制或环境限制的问题
本文将深入探讨如何在VMware环境中使用Aircrack进行无线网络安全测试,以及这一方法的重要性和优势
一、Aircrack简介及其重要性 Aircrack是一款开源的无线网络破解工具,它利用无线网络通信协议中的漏洞进行攻击,能够破解WEP、WPA和WPA2等加密方式的无线网络密码
Aircrack通过捕获无线网络的数据包,分析其中的加密信息,最终恢复出无线网络的密钥
这一工具在安全测试、网络渗透测试以及网络安全教育等领域具有广泛的应用价值
Aircrack的重要性在于,它能够帮助安全测试人员及时发现无线网络中的安全漏洞,并采取相应的措施进行修复
同时,通过学习和掌握Aircrack的使用方法,可以提升个人在无线网络安全领域的技能水平,为未来的职业发展打下坚实的基础
二、VMware环境概述 VMware是一款虚拟化软件,它能够在单一物理机上运行多个操作系统实例,这些实例被称为虚拟机
VMware通过虚拟化技术,实现了硬件资源的共享和高效利用,使得用户可以在不增加物理硬件的情况下,灵活地部署和管理多个操作系统和应用软件
在网络安全测试领域,VMware环境具有显著的优势
首先,VMware环境能够模拟各种真实的网络环境,为安全测试人员提供了丰富的测试场景
其次,通过虚拟机之间的隔离,可以有效地避免测试过程中的安全风险,保护物理机的安全
最后,VMware环境还支持快照功能,能够方便地保存和恢复测试环境,提高测试效率
三、Aircrack在VMware环境中的部署与配置 要在VMware环境中使用Aircrack进行无线网络安全测试,首先需要完成以下步骤: 1.准备VMware环境和虚拟机 下载并安装VMware Workstation或VMware Player等虚拟化软件
然后,创建一个新的虚拟机,并安装一个支持Aircrack的操作系统,如Linux(推荐使用Ubuntu或Kali Linux)
2.安装Aircrack套件 在虚拟机中,打开终端或命令行界面,使用包管理器(如apt-get)安装Aircrack套件
在Ubuntu或Kali Linux中,可以通过以下命令进行安装: bash sudo apt-get update sudo apt-get install aircrack-ng 3.配置虚拟机网络适配器 在VMware中,为虚拟机配置一个桥接网络适配器
这样,虚拟机将能够直接连接到物理网络,捕获到真实的无线网络数据包
需要注意的是,桥接模式可能会使虚拟机暴露在风险之中,因此在进行测试前,应确保虚拟机中的系统已经进行了必要的安全配置
4.安装无线网卡驱动程序 在虚拟机中使用Aircrack之前,需要确保无线网卡驱动程序已经正确安装
对于不同的无线网卡和Linux发行版,驱动程序的安装方法可能会有所不同
通常,可以通过Linux内核自带的驱动程序或厂商提供的驱动程序进行安装
5.验证Aircrack安装 安装完成后,可以通过在终端中输入`aircrack-ng -v`命令来验证Aircrack是否安装成功
如果命令能够正确执行并显示版本号等信息,则说明Aircrack已经成功安装
四、Aircrack在VMware环境中的使用 在VMware环境中成功部署和配置Aircrack后,就可以开始使用它进行无线网络安全测试了
以下是一个简单的测试流程: 1.捕获无线网络数据包 使用Aircrack套件中的`airodump-ng`命令捕获无线网络数据包
该命令可以显示附近的无线网络信息,包括SSID、信道、加密方式等
通过指定无线网卡和信道等参数,可以捕获特定无线网络的数据包
例如: bash sudo airodump-ng -i wlan0mon -c 6 --bssid XX:XX:XX:XX:XX:XX -w capture 其中,`wlan0mon`是无线网卡的监控模式接口名,`6`是信道号,`XX:XX:XX:XX:XX:XX`是目标无线网络的BSSID(基站标识),`capture`是捕获的数据包保存的文件名前缀
2.分析捕获的数据包 使用`aircrack-ng`命令对捕获的数据包进行分析,尝试恢复出无线网络的密钥
该命令需要指定捕获的数据包文件
例如: bash sudo aircrack-ng -a 2 -b XX:XX:XX:XX:XX:XX capture-.cap 其中,`-a 2`表示使用WPA/WPA2加密方式进行分析,`XX:XX:XX:XX:XX:XX`是目标无线网络的BSSID,`capture-.cap`是捕获的数据包文件
3.验证密钥 如果分析成功,Aircrack将显示恢复出的无线网络密钥
此时,可以使用该密钥连接到目标无线网络,验证其正确性
五、Aircrack在VMware环境中的优势与挑战 在VMware环境中使用Aircrack进行无线网络安全测试具有显著的优势: - 灵活性:VMware环境支持多种操作系统和硬件配置,使得Aircrack能够在不同的测试环境中灵活部署
- 安全性:通过虚拟机之间的隔离和快照功能,可以有效地降低测试过程中的安全风险
- 成本效益:使用VMware环境可以避免购买昂贵的硬件设备,降低测试成本
然而,在VMware环境中使用Aircrack也面临一些挑战: - 性能限制:虚拟机中的无线网卡性能可能受到虚拟化层的影响,导致捕获数据包的速度和效率降低
- 兼容性问题:部分无线网卡可能无法在虚拟机中正常工作或无法支持监控模式,需要选择适合的无线网卡和驱动程序
- 法律风险:在使用Aircrack进行无线网络安全测试时,应遵守相关法律法规和道德规范,避免侵犯他人的合法权益
六、结论 Aircrack作为一款强大的无线网络破解工具,在网络安全测试领域具有广泛的应用价值
通过在VMware环境中部署和配置Aircrack,可以灵活地进行无线网络安全测试,发现潜在的安全漏洞并采取相应的修复措施
然而,在使用Aircrack时,也需要注意性能限制、兼容性问题以及法律风险等方面的问题
未来,随着虚拟化技术的不断发展和完善,相信Aircrack在VMware环境中的应用将会更加广泛和深入
总之,无线网络安全是网络安全领域的重要组成部分,通过学习和掌握Aircrack等安全测试工具的使用方法,可以提升个人在无线网络安全领域的技能水平,为未来的职业发展打下坚实的基础
同时,我们也应时刻保持警惕,加强网络安全意识,共同维护网络空间的安全与稳定